#include #include #define REP(i, n) for(int i = 0; i < n; i++) #define FOR(i, m, n) for(int i = m; i < n; i++) using namespace std; typedef vector VI; int main() { int n;cin >> n; VI a(n); REP(i, n) cin >> a[i]; FOR(i, 1, 2 * n - 3) REP(p, n) if (i - pp&&a[i - p] < a[p]) swap(a[i - p], a[p]); REP(i, n) cout << a[i] << " "; cout << endl; }